Portage de Sioux Picnic Ride

Participation in STLRC Rides & Hikes is at your own risk. STLRC assumes no liability.

All rides are free for St. Louis Recreational Cyclists members. Non-members must join by their second ride.

 Starting Location: Portage des Sioux Nature Area at Main and Saucier, Portage du Sioux

Arrival Time:  8:45 am

Time of Departure:  9:00 am

Description:  An almost flat ride up to 30 miles to enjoy the popular fried chicken dinner in Portage des Sioux.  Use the posted cue sheet.  There are 2 routes available–20 and 30 miles.  This is a flat ride but we will cross several railroad tracks.  After the ride we will attend the picnic.  Food service begins at noon.  Cost is $17.00.    Tables will be in large dining hall and outside seating There will be raffles, games, and a truck pull at the picnic.

Restrooms at the church where the picnic is held.
